Drought is an important stressor that affects plant growth, survival and physiology and, through plant responses, alters plant-herbivore interactions and herbivore population dynamics. Short-term drought can occur at different times during a growing season, affecting herbivore populations and plants at various stages of development and growth. As phenology influences drought response, drought timing could strongly structure plant-herbivore interactions. We grew common milkweed plants with or without its dominant aphid herbivore, allowing both plants and herbivore populations to develop over time as in a typical growing season. To determine how drought timing affects plants and aphid populations, we applied short-term (1 week) drought at different times. Plants and aphids were sensitive to drought timing, with a few weeks difference shifting the effects of drought from minimal to causing massive declines in plant growth, plant survival and herbivore population density.
